Howard Jones (born July 20, ) is an American metalcore vocalist best known as the former lead singer of Killswitch Engage and Blood Has Been Shed. He is the current vocalist of Light the Torch, formerly known as Devil You Know, and SION with YouTuber/guitarist Jared Dines.

Career

Jones started making music in the underground band Driven in , releasing a single album. He later performed with Blood Has Been Shed from to In , he joined Killswitch Engage as their new vocalist after Jesse Leach left the band. During his time with Killswitch Engage, they released two gold-certified albums, The End of Heartache and As Daylight Dies, as well as a second self-titled album. Jones left the band after nearly ten years in , but remained a close friend. He would go on to collaborate with them again for the single "The Signal Fire" from their album Atonement. His later band Light the Torch would also tour with Killswitch Engage, and he would appear with the band onstage to perform the song, as well as other songs from his time with them, often as a duet alongside Leach.

Jones started a new band Devil You Know with guitarist Francesco Artusato (All Shall Perish) and drummer John Sankey (Devolved, Fear Factory and Divine Heresy). After Sankey's departure and his attempt to claim the copyright of the band's name, the rest of the band members started again with a fresh name, Light the Torch, with the addition of a new drummer.

In March , Jones joined with heavy metal YouTuberJared Dines and producer Hiram Hernandez to release "The Blade" as part of a new project named Sion.[4]

On December 3rd , Jones via his Instagram confirmed that He and former Killswitch Engage bandmate Adam Dutkiewicz were almost finished mixing a Debut Album for their new Band called Burn Eternal.[5]

Personal life

Jones is an avid fisherman and owns property on the Red River of the North in Manitoba, Canada. He is a frequent guest on Jamey Jasta's podcast on the GaS Digital Network. Jones left Killswitch Engage in early to allow himself to manage his type 2 diabetes, which was worsened by a hectic touring lifestyle.[6] In , Jones stated that his diabetes put him in a coma for three days.[7]

In , Jones revealed that he had struggled with anxiety and depression for a long time, which had been worsened by his rise to fame in Killswitch Engage. He revealed that he had come close to committing suicide in , when he had aimed a Magnum revolver at his head in his apartment in Connecticut, and that the police had intervened after being notified by a concerned neighbor.[8] In , he teamed up with his former band to raise awareness for mental health;[9] the resulting song "The Signal Fire" appears on the album Atonement.[10]

Although formerly straight edge,[11] Jones now shares a passion for medical cannabis with friend and fellow Killswitch Engage frontman Jesse Leach.[9]
